Heat treatment of a bare single-domain lithium niobate plate at somewhat lower temperatures than the Curie temperature causes a local polarization reversal, thereby yielding a ferroelectric inversion layer. The depth profile of passive layers on Fe/Cr alloys has been examined with ion scattering spectroscopy (ISS). The monolayer depth resolution of the method permits determination of a detailed Fe/Cr profile which may not be obtained with other methods. Cr is accumulated in the center of the passive film.
